Перейти из форума на сайт.

НовостиФайловые архивы
ПоискАктивные темыТоп лист
ПравилаКто в on-line?
Вход Забыли пароль? Первый раз на этом сайте? Регистрация
Компьютерный форум Ru.Board » Компьютеры » Программы » Opera на движке Presto (часть 26)

Модерирует : gyra, Maz

Maz (03-12-2019 21:42): Opera на движке Presto (часть 27)  Версия для печати • ПодписатьсяДобавить в закладки
Страницы: 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 46 47 48 49 50 51 52 53 54 55 56 57 58 59 60 61 62 63 64 65 66 67 68 69 70 71 72 73 74 75 76 77 78 79 80 81 82 83 84 85 86 87 88 89 90 91 92 93 94 95 96 97 98 99 100 101 102 103 104 105 106 107 108 109 110 111 112 113 114 115 116 117 118 119 120 121 122 123 124 125 126 127 128 129 130 131 132 133 134 135 136 137 138 139 140 141 142 143 144 145 146 147 148 149 150 151 152 153 154 155 156 157 158 159 160 161 162 163 164 165 166 167 168 169 170 171 172 173 174 175 176 177 178 179 180 181 182 183 184 185 186 187 188 189 190 191 192 193 194 195 196 197 198 199

   

gyra

Moderator
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
Предыдущие части | часть 25  «Oпepа Presto || другие версии, выше v12 (Blink) - здecь»Уcтaнoвка:
 - На переносной USB-накопитель [Stand-alone installation USB] РЕКОМЕНДУЕМ! ... Пример
 - Для всех пользователей [All users on this computer] ...
 - Для текущего пользователя [Current user] ...

Настройка:
  • Полное описание настроек (opera:config) | Советы | Назначения файлов
  • Обход сообщений сайтов "Ваш браузер устарел" (маскировка под другие браузеры)
  • Если на странице сайта вместо букв - "квадратики/иероглифы"
  • Известные проблемы и их решения | Проблемы версий 12.15-16-17
  • Настройка просмотра видео на YouTube и других сайтах

    Другие темы по Опере Presto:
  • Плагины/утилиты/расширения/кнопки/панели
  • Моды меню, русификация
  • Скины/Темы
  • Сборки | Opera AC
  • forum.timsky.ru — патчи, сборка и развитие утекших исходников Opera 12.15 [открытый форум]
  • MyOpera.net — информационный портал | Форум
  • OperaFan.net — информационный портал | Форум (остался только фрагментарный веб-архив)
  • Еще ресурсы | Голосования | Обсуждение содержимого этой шапки.

  • Всего записей: 7932 | Зарегистр. 18-02-2006 | Отправлено: 00:39 05-11-2017 | Исправлено: VladDr, 02:46 21-09-2019
    tmpl

    Advanced Member
    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
    dansn

    Цитата:
    site_livejournal.com.js

     
    Спасибо, в блогах тоже все ок.

    Всего записей: 1274 | Зарегистр. 22-03-2008 | Отправлено: 20:46 05-10-2019
    cpm1a

    Junior Member
    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
    https://github.com/Gemorroj/noads-advanced/archive/v1.3.7.zip
    скачал. как его устанавливать?  файла *.oex в архиве нет. и вообще стоит  пытаться поставить именно последнюю версию? у меня  сейчас noads-advanced-1.3.6-1
     
    спасибо

    Всего записей: 111 | Зарегистр. 12-10-2018 | Отправлено: 08:40 06-10-2019 | Исправлено: cpm1a, 08:40 06-10-2019
    C1eriC



    Advanced Member
    Редактировать | Профиль | Сообщение | ICQ | Цитировать | Сообщить модератору
    VladDr

    Цитата:
    Taм пoлный иcxoдный кoд нyжeн. Hy и нe зaбывaть чтo глaвнoe – нaличиe жeлaния y paзбиpaющиxcя зaнимaтьcя этим.

    Да, я понимаю, тут всё на добровольных началах.
     
    На самом деле, быть залогиненым не обязательно. Можно открыть любую статью на мобильной версии, например. Если навести курсор мыши в Опере (проверял на чистой) на кнопку (иконку) внизу статьи (справа), «закладки», то курсор не изменится. Или же на кнопку-иконку внизу статьи посередине, «число просмотров» — курсор не изменит вид. Если же тоже самое сделать в ФФ, то иконка курсора мыши изменится. Думаю, если разобраться почему такое происходит (точнее не происходит), то это и будет ответ на вопрос почему не нажимаются кнопки. Аккаунт иметь не обязательно, достаточно открыть исходный код страницы. Моих небогатых знаний js, css, html тут уже не хватает.

    Всего записей: 945 | Зарегистр. 15-06-2013 | Отправлено: 10:14 06-10-2019
    billibons

    Advanced Member
    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
    cpm1a
    Ответил в соседней теме.

    Всего записей: 1657 | Зарегистр. 15-12-2005 | Отправлено: 11:01 06-10-2019
    VladDr

    Silver Member
    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
    C1eriC
    Цитата:
    Если навести курсор мыши в Опере (проверял на чистой) на кнопку (иконку) внизу статьи (справа), «закладки», то курсор не изменится.

     Пoxoжe нa нecoвмecтимocть т.к. в 31-м xpoмoм тoжe не меняeтся, a в 37-м меняeтся.

    Всего записей: 2240 | Зарегистр. 05-06-2010 | Отправлено: 18:58 06-10-2019
    s12b

    Member
    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
    Не знаю где спросить про основы ХТМЛ:  
    тут ранее мне подсказали, что переключатель сортировки на сайте Медузы хранится вовсе не в куках.
    Теперь аналогичный вопрос про Личный Кабинет у сотового оператора Теле2:
    при восстановлении куков, сохраненных до привязки новых номеров, эти новые номера не видны в списке и общее кол-во привязанных номеров показывается старое.
    Если куки стереть и зайти как в первый раз - все показывает правильно.
    Мой вопрос: с какого бодуна список и даже кол-во номеров для ЛК может храниться в куках и иметь приоритет перед инфой из самого ЛК, получаемой от сервера самого Теле2?
     
    Где про такое спрашивать лучше? У меня периодически возникают подобные вопросы - извините, что я к вам обращаюсь...

    Всего записей: 361 | Зарегистр. 12-08-2010 | Отправлено: 20:33 06-10-2019 | Исправлено: s12b, 20:35 06-10-2019
    Bladru

    Advanced Member
    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
    C1eriC
    Без регистрации у меня на m.habr.com вроде бы всё работает с Object.assign.js и String.prototype.includes.js (зеркало).
     
    Курсор не меняется из-за того, что в Опере не работает :after{cursor:pointer}. Это ни на что не влияет, клик всё равно добирается до onBookmarkClick. Там над кнопкой выбора периода курсор тоже не меняется, но меню работает.

    Всего записей: 655 | Зарегистр. 09-10-2006 | Отправлено: 22:01 06-10-2019
    C1eriC



    Advanced Member
    Редактировать | Профиль | Сообщение | ICQ | Цитировать | Сообщить модератору
    VladDr
    Bladru
    Да, с этим скриптом курсор меняется. Надеялся что дело в этом (типа курсор кнопку не находит), но нет, кнопки голосования так же не работают.
     
    Положил исходный код этой страницы сюда.
    Неработающая кнопка описывается так:
    Код:
    <div class="tm-comment-votes-switcher tm-comments-list__votes-switcher">
        <div class="tm-comment-votes-switcher__title">
            <div class="tm-votes-lever tm-comment-votes-switcher__votes-switcher tm-votes-lever_xlarge">
                <span class="tm-svg-icon__wrapper tm-votes-icon tm-votes-lever__icon">ev
                    <svg height="16" width="16" class="tm-svg-img tm-svg-icon">
                        <use xlink:href="/img/megazord-v7.svg#counter-vote" />
                    </svg>
                    <::after>
                </span>

    На ней подвешены вот эти event. Которые, почему-то, не срабатывают

    Всего записей: 945 | Зарегистр. 15-06-2013 | Отправлено: 08:43 07-10-2019
    Bladru

    Advanced Member
    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
    C1eriC
    У меня работают эти кнопки. Посмотри на вкладке Network, там после клика должен быть XHR куда-нибудь на "https://m.habr.com/kek/v1/comments/20718557/votes/up?". У меня он возвращает "401 Unauthorized" и появляется плашка с ошибкой. Плашки можешь посмотреть с .noty_effects_open {opacity: 1 !important;}. Можешь ещё defer_emulator.js подключить. В консоли ошибок нет? Поставь breakpoint на event: click и посмотри, срабатывает ли он.

    Всего записей: 655 | Зарегистр. 09-10-2006 | Отправлено: 12:54 07-10-2019
    C1eriC



    Advanced Member
    Редактировать | Профиль | Сообщение | ICQ | Цитировать | Сообщить модератору
    Bladru
    Попробовал нажать на кнопку при открытой вкладке Сеть, на POST https://m.habr.com/kek/v1/comments/20720905/votes/up? ответ HTTP/1.1 403 Forbidden и потом {"message":"invalid csrf token". Я залогинен, куки глобально включены. Т.о. клик срабатывает, но сайт не даёт выполнить действие. Что ему может не нравится?
     
    .noty_effects_open {opacity: 1 !important;} пробовал прописывать в user css, но не увидел разницы. Плашка с ошибкой не появлялась ни до ни после.
     
    В консоли ошибок нет. А как подключить defer_emulator.js и что это такое?
     
    Кстати, без core.min.js (core-js 2.6.9) вообще ничего не работает.

    Всего записей: 945 | Зарегистр. 15-06-2013 | Отправлено: 14:37 07-10-2019 | Исправлено: C1eriC, 14:47 07-10-2019
    Bladru

    Advanced Member
    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
    C1eriC
    Попробуй с таким скриптом.

    Всего записей: 655 | Зарегистр. 09-10-2006 | Отправлено: 03:54 08-10-2019 | Исправлено: Bladru, 21:50 08-10-2019
    C1eriC



    Advanced Member
    Редактировать | Профиль | Сообщение | ICQ | Цитировать | Сообщить модератору
    Bladru
    Ура, заработало! Спасибо большое!
    А что это было? В чём была проблема?

    Всего записей: 945 | Зарегистр. 15-06-2013 | Отправлено: 06:29 08-10-2019
    Bladru

    Advanced Member
    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
    C1eriC
    Они делают delete внутри for in, и из-за этого следующий элемент пропускается, и заголовок "csrf-token" не добавляется к запросу. Можешь баг репорт разрабам отправить. Это код из axios, но тут скорее баг Оперы.

    Всего записей: 655 | Зарегистр. 09-10-2006 | Отправлено: 08:19 08-10-2019 | Исправлено: Bladru, 22:02 08-10-2019
    C1eriC



    Advanced Member
    Редактировать | Профиль | Сообщение | ICQ | Цитировать | Сообщить модератору
    Bladru
    Написал. Ответили:
    «К сожалению, мы не можем гарантировать корректную работу сайта во всех версиях всех существующих в мире браузеров. Мы контролируем и стараемся обеспечивать корректную работу сайта только в последних версиях популярных браузеров. Оценка популярности производится на основе статистики доступа пользователей к нашему сайту».
     
    Ещё раз спасибо за скрипт! Опера 12 ещё могёт!

    Всего записей: 945 | Зарегистр. 15-06-2013 | Отправлено: 14:00 08-10-2019
    cpm1a

    Junior Member
    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
    12.18 и drive.google.com...  
     
    пробовал:
    Abs_mod1.2_rus.oex
    opera.dll_12.16_32bit_user-agents.zip
     
    в учётку захожу, но  
    the server encountered an error, try again later...

    Всего записей: 111 | Зарегистр. 12-10-2018 | Отправлено: 20:37 08-10-2019 | Исправлено: cpm1a, 10:16 09-10-2019
    Gimmor

    Full Member
    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
    Друзья!
    У меня последнее время проблема  с Opera Dragonfly...
    У них адрес сменился, а меня не предупредили?  
    Помогите, плз, offline файлом. Или правильным Developer Tools URL.
    Спасибо.

    Всего записей: 556 | Зарегистр. 24-05-2010 | Отправлено: 22:13 08-10-2019 | Исправлено: Gimmor, 22:13 08-10-2019
    Bladru

    Advanced Member
    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
    Gimmor
    https://dragonfly.opera.com/app/
    https://dragonfly.opera.com/app/cutting-edge/
     
    https://dragonfly.opera.com/app/stp-1/zips/latest/client-en.zip
    https://dragonfly.opera.com/app/stp-1/zips/latest/client-ru.zip
    https://dragonfly.opera.com/app/stp-1/cutting-edge/zips/latest/client-en.zip
    https://dragonfly.opera.com/app/stp-1/cutting-edge/zips/latest/client-ru.zip
     
    Есть ещё experimental, но он багнутый.

    Всего записей: 655 | Зарегистр. 09-10-2006 | Отправлено: 22:26 08-10-2019
    Gimmor

    Full Member
    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
    Bladru
    Прямые ссылки не подошли у меня. Выкидывает в file://localhost/D:\Program Files (x86)\Opera 12.14\profile\temporary_downloads\...
    Из 4-х других выбрал русские.
    Постоянно так:
     

     
    Ума не приложу, что делать и почему так вышло...
     
    Большое спасибо! Чуть не забыл...

    Всего записей: 556 | Зарегистр. 24-05-2010 | Отправлено: 22:42 08-10-2019 | Исправлено: Gimmor, 22:43 08-10-2019
    Bladru

    Advanced Member
    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
    Gimmor
    Цитата:
    Выкидывает в file://localhost/D:\Program Files (x86)\Opera 12.14\profile\temporary_downloads\

    Проверь Preferences > Advanced > Downloads > "application/xhtml+xml".

    Всего записей: 655 | Зарегистр. 09-10-2006 | Отправлено: 22:57 08-10-2019
    Gimmor

    Full Member
    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
    Bladru написал(а)
    Цитата:
    Проверь

    Проверил...
     

     
    А как надо?

    Всего записей: 556 | Зарегистр. 24-05-2010 | Отправлено: 23:02 08-10-2019
       

    Страницы: 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 46 47 48 49 50 51 52 53 54 55 56 57 58 59 60 61 62 63 64 65 66 67 68 69 70 71 72 73 74 75 76 77 78 79 80 81 82 83 84 85 86 87 88 89 90 91 92 93 94 95 96 97 98 99 100 101 102 103 104 105 106 107 108 109 110 111 112 113 114 115 116 117 118 119 120 121 122 123 124 125 126 127 128 129 130 131 132 133 134 135 136 137 138 139 140 141 142 143 144 145 146 147 148 149 150 151 152 153 154 155 156 157 158 159 160 161 162 163 164 165 166 167 168 169 170 171 172 173 174 175 176 177 178 179 180 181 182 183 184 185 186 187 188 189 190 191 192 193 194 195 196 197 198 199

    Компьютерный форум Ru.Board » Компьютеры » Программы » Opera на движке Presto (часть 26)
    Maz (03-12-2019 21:42): Opera на движке Presto (часть 27)


    Реклама на форуме Ru.Board.

    Powered by Ikonboard "v2.1.7b" © 2000 Ikonboard.com
    Modified by Ru.B0ard
    © Ru.B0ard 2000-2024

    BitCoin: 1NGG1chHtUvrtEqjeerQCKDMUi6S6CG4iC

    Рейтинг.ru